So many people have the dream of becoming millionaires but don't know they steps or what to do in order to archive that. I'll list and explain things we should do when aspiring to become rich:
Define what "rich" means to you: Before you start your journey to becoming rich, you need to define what "rich" means to you. Is it having a certain amount of money in the bank, owning a luxurious car, or having a successful business? Defining what "rich" means to you will help you set clear goals and strategies to achieve them.
Create a financial plan: A financial plan is essential if you want to become rich. It should include your income, expenses, savings, and investments. It's also important to track your spending and adjust your plan as your financial situation changes.
Develop a strong work ethic: To become rich, you need to have a strong work ethic. This means being disciplined, persistent, and dedicated to your goals. You may need to work long hours, take on extra projects, or learn new skills to get ahead.
Invest in yourself: Investing in yourself is one of the best things you can do to become rich. This includes improving your skills, education, and knowledge. Attend seminars, read books, take online courses, and network with successful people in your field.
Take calculated risks: Becoming rich often requires taking risks. However, it's important to take calculated risks that have the potential for high rewards. Don't gamble your money on risky ventures that have little chance of success.
Surround yourself with successful people: Surrounding yourself with successful people can be a great source of inspiration and motivation. Seek out mentors, join networking groups, and attend conferences and events in your field.
Stay focused and persistent: Becoming rich takes time and effort. Stay focused on your goals, and don't get discouraged by setbacks. Stay persistent and keep working towards your goals, even when it seems like progress is slow.
Be smart with your money: Once you start making money, it's important to be smart with it. Avoid overspending and impulse purchases, and invest in assets that will grow in value over time.
Give back: Lastly, becoming rich shouldn't just be about accumulating wealth for yourself. Giving back to your community and helping others can bring fulfillment and happiness, and also contribute to your success in the long run.
